Problem

Conventional card edge connectors damage electrical cards due to slantwise resisting surfaces during insertion, and they face issues with terminal alignment and distortion when soldered onto PCBs.

Innovation Solution

A card edge connector design featuring an insulative housing with slantwise guiding surfaces and parallel resisting surfaces on latch members to reduce card damage, along with adjustable welding members that can be flattened for better alignment with the PCB.

AI summary

A card edge connector defines an insulative housing, the housing includes a lengthwise base portion with opposite end walls along a lengthwise direction thereof, and a card-receiving slot runs forwards for an electrical card; a plurality of terminals are loaded in the housing and the terminals defines contacting portions exposing to the card-receiving slot and welding portions extending out of the housing; a pair of latch members are fixed to the end walls, each latch member comprises a locking portion, the locking portion bends inwards and downwards slantwise, the locking portion also defines an upper guiding surface and a lower resisting surface opposite to the upper guiding surface, wherein the guiding surfaces are disposed slantwise to the electrical card while the resisting surface is parallel to the electrical card.
